pub struct CypherQueryBuilder { /* private fields */ }Implementations§
Source§impl CypherQueryBuilder
impl CypherQueryBuilder
pub fn new() -> Self
pub fn raw(self, fragment: impl AsRef<str>) -> Self
pub fn match_node(self, alias: &str, label: &str) -> Self
pub fn where_eq(self, alias: &str, field: &str, value: &str) -> Self
pub fn return_fields(self, fields: impl AsRef<str>) -> Self
pub fn build(self) -> GraphQuery
Trait Implementations§
Auto Trait Implementations§
impl Freeze for CypherQueryBuilder
impl RefUnwindSafe for CypherQueryBuilder
impl Send for CypherQueryBuilder
impl Sync for CypherQueryBuilder
impl Unpin for CypherQueryBuilder
impl UnsafeUnpin for CypherQueryBuilder
impl UnwindSafe for CypherQueryBuilder
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more